In current example we are going to create a File Format data store, which will be connected to AWS SFTP via ssh key, sample project task which will be pulling data from file, stored on SFTP server, map data and save into database table.
Prerequisites:
- CPI DS is up and running, including DS Agent service running on Windows.
- S3 Buckets are enabled on AWS and we have read/write access into buckets.
- AWS Transfer for SFTP service is enabled in AWS Console on top of S3 Bucket Service.
- Hana Database is running and connected from CPI DS.
Generate SSH Keys from DS Agent machine.
Open Command line and navigate to C:ProgramDataSAPDataServicesAgentconfkeyssftp
Enter command ssh-keygen.

Specify full path to save keys.
Enter passphrase.
As a result 2 files should be created under C:ProgramDataSAPDataServicesAgentconfkeyssftp
Where first is a private key and second is a public key.
Upload SSH Key into AWS Transfer for SFTP.

Login to AWS Console.
Navigate to AWS Transfer for SFTP Service.
Open user which will be used for connectivity with CPI DS. Add new ssh key.

Open public key file content, copy content and add new ssh key via AWS Console. Save.
